I got spamassaim working and now i´m trying to check if bayes is working, I manually feed bayes database with about 10000 spams already marked as spam by spamassasim, now I´m looking at the headers of new emails and have no idea of what to look to check if bayes is working.

Look for X-Spam-Status headers containing BAYES_## where ## is 00, 50, 95, 99, etc.

Also, make sure you train SA on some ham (nonspam) as well... SA's bayes engine can't distinguish between spam and ham unless it's seen some of both.
